3.2 Project Background

The National Climate Change Response Policy White Paper (NCCRPW) has acknowledged that

energy efficiency and demand side management, coupled with increasing investment in

renewable energy programmes, are the most promising greenhouse gas (GHG) emission

mitigation options in the electricity sector.

The national energy efficiency improvements commitments were affirmed in the National

Energy Efficiency Strategy (NEES) that was developed and published in 2005 with economy-

wide energy intensity reduction of 12% by 2015 against the baseline of 2000.

The implementation of the 2005 NEES resulted in an economy-wide energy efficiency

improvement of 21.4% by 2015 due to a number of interventions that were adopted in

various sectors.

However, since the 2005 NEES came to an end in 2015 the Department of Energy started a

process to develop the post-2015 NEES to determine new energy efficiency measures and

targets for the period of 2016 to 2030 in line with the requirements of the Medium Term

Strategy Framework (MTSF), National Development Plan, Integrated Energy Plan, Integrated

Resource Plan for Electricity, and the South Africa’s National Climate Change Response Policy

White Paper.

The proposed post-2015 energy efficiency measures are, amongst others, expected to have a

16% economic wide reduction in energy consumption attributed to energy efficiency

improvements by 2030 relative to 2015 baseline.

The achievements of the South Africa’s climate change goals will not only address the

country’s social, economic and environmental aspects but will also act as a catalyst for the

acceleration of the integration of energy efficient and renewable energy technologies.

It is in this context that South African National Energy Development Institute (SANEDI) is

supporting the Department of Mineral Resources and Energy (DMRE) to coordinate the

implementation of a number of Energy Efficiency and Demand Side Management projects

that will improve energy data collection, data management and analysis in South Africa.

3.3 SPECIFIC OBJECTIVES OF THE PROJECTS

Strengthen energy efficiency related target setting through improved data and reporting on energy consumption and potential savings covering among others the following:

3.3.1 Energy consumption baseline assessment and formulation including mapping of energy performance covering energy savings potential, potential penetration and main challenges of Energy Management Systems (EnMS) and Energy System Optimisation (ESO) in line with ISO 50006 methodologies within selected sectors and sub-sectors.

3.3.2 EnMS and ESO best practice technology and process benchmarks including periodical reviews and updates in selected industry sub-sectors.

3.3.3 Targeted technical assistance and capacity building to enhance and implement Energy Efficient policies, incentives and regulatory frameworks supporting EnMS and ESO uptake and strengthening the coordination of associated activities across government departments and agencies.

3.4 SCOPE OF WORK 3.4.1 Support the data collection work process and technical capacity to collect,

process and analyse end-use data and installed technologies in selected sub-sectors of industry, residential or public sector

3.4.2 Review and update tools and methodologies that will enhance data collection, processing and analysis.

3.4.3 Propose data management stakeholder matrix for data access and data quality improvements.

3.4.4 Conduct selected sector or sub-sector energy efficiency benchmarking methodology and proposed best practice approach on EnMS and ESO for these sectors or sub-sectors to be adopted by DMRE/SANEDI.

3.4.5 Develop and/or update data collection, data management and data analysis methodologies, tools and instruments.

3.4.6 Collect energy data and formulate energy consumption baselines and develop

energy end-use data and technology catalogues with the baseline information

and data for selected industry, residential or public sub-sectors.
